Lot 3" Blk. 1 B.S. - Design Review - Par4ing Lot Exp ansion - Avon
service Center
Wright stated that at the February 17, 1987, Planning and Zoning
Commission meeting, the Commission adopted Resolution 87-7,
recommending that the Town Council approve a Special Review Use to
allow off-site parking on Lot 32, Block 1, to serve Lot 33, Block 1,
Bencnmark at Beaver Creek. Council approved this Special Review Use at
its meeting of February 24, 1987, with the condition that the applicant
submit a detailed site, grading and drainage, and landscaping plan for
Planning and Zoning Commission review and approval. Peel/Warren
Architects, on behalf of the owner of Lot 32, Block 1, have submitted a
site plan for the proposed parking lot for design review. The plan
calls for construction of 37 parking spaces, runoff treatment
facilities, and landscaping on Lot 32. This lot is proposed to link
with the existing parking on Lot 33, and have a separate access off
Nottingham Road.
Kathy Warren, architect and representative of owner stated that due to
-the time schedule, 'the engineer- had not been able to double-check the
plans, therefore some dimensioning, pipe inverts, and back-up
engineering data would oe available when the building permit is applied
for. Lot 32's drainage will use an additional new filter gallery plus
feed into the existing filter gallery on Lot 33. There are 2 filter
galleries on Lot 33 because of the lay of the land, 1 each for the
front and side of the building. Warren stated that the existing light
pole had been relocated from the front of the building between the
inlet to the parking and some parking spaces, to a central location to
help light Lot 32. The light from the building helps light Lot 33.
is located where cars can't back into it and snowplows can't damage it.
Wood stated that one of the primary concerns is that the entrances be
lit.
Donaldson asked what type of irrigation system would be used.
Warren stated it is a drip system and there is an existing culvert
under the parking lot on Lot 33, and this can be tied into the existing
drip system.

Other Business
Wood stated that updates on the Eagle County 1041 permit process for
Homestake II project include review of the 1041 permit application,
along with other related documents. The approach that has been taken
is looking for weal: spots in the application such as areas that they
either have not addressed or have only partially addressed, or outright
misleading information in addressing the issues, and trying to find
ways to deal with the permit. Staff has also been in touch with the
various metro districts, sewer districts, water districts, and other
towns in the area. We have to have a letter into the County by March
20, 1987, requesting party status. Party status gives the right to
cross-examine other witnesses for or against the applicant. Wood
stated that points of concern include: 1) socio-economic impacts;
2) recreation impacts; 3) water quality impacts; 4) water quantity
impacts; 5) impacts on aquatic habitat; and 6) potential impacts in
other areas that may become apparent during further review of the
application.
